Climate Cabinet Logo is looking for a Data Engineer on a contract basis to enhance and maintain our vital data infrastructure and tooling. This role is pivotal in identifying and leveraging opportunities to support the election of pro-climate candidates and the passage of impactful pro-climate legislation.
What You'll Do
- Design and maintain robust backend systems, data pipelines, and cloud-based storage and processing to support large-scale electoral and civic data analysis.
- Ensure the accuracy and completeness of data related to 500,000+ local offices, and regularly update databases with external data sources like LegiScan and Open States.
- Build out internal toolset with applications that streamline operations, such as custom database interfaces for tracking electoral data and fundraising activities.
- Develop methodologies for calculating metrics, analyze data, and generate visualizations to support Political, Policy, Comms, and Development teams.
- Build out AI-powered tools and connect datasets to provide self-serve policy analysis and data visualization tools.
- Take the lead on specific projects agreed with the team and provide code review and input on projects led by other team members.
What We're Looking For
- Proficiency in Python for data analysis and manipulation.
- Experience with SQL and database management (e.g., PostgreSQL, MySQL).
- Fluency with Github for version control.
- Experience building and managing data systems via Google Cloud Platform (preferred) or AWS.
- Experience orchestrating ETL pipelines on cloud infrastructure (using Apache Airflow, Cloud Run, Cloud Functions, etc.).
- Ability to work with APIs and integrate various data sources.
- Knowledge of data visualization tools (e.g., Tableau, Power BI, D3.js).
- Familiarity with political data sources and electoral processes (e.g. Legiscan, Open States, BillTrack50) and proficiency with data analysis, particularly political data.
Nice to Have
- Knowledge of AI tools.
- Comfort with AI in workflow (Github Copilot, Claude Code, etc).
- Knowledge of building AI applications (MCPs, LLM integrations, etc).
Technical Stack
- Languages & Databases: Python, PostgreSQL, MySQL
- Tools & Platforms: Github, Google Cloud Platform, AWS, Apache Airflow, Cloud Run, Cloud Functions
- Visualization: Tableau, Power BI, D3.js
Team & Environment
You will join a small, tight-knit engineering team and collaborate closely with the Tech Team, managing work via Jira and Github.
Work Mode
This is a remote contract position and is open to candidates located anywhere in the United States. We are a remote-first workplace.
Climate Cabinet is an equal opportunity employer. Climate Cabinet believes every employee has the right to work in an environment free from unlawful discrimination.





